PSVR2 Showing Might be Coming “Very Soon” – Rumour

Journalist Jeff Grubb says he has heard "rumblings" that Sony intends to show off the PSVR2 in "a more substantial way" in the near future.

Over the last few months, Sony has continued its slow and steady rollout of new details on the upcoming PSVR2, but even though plenty has been said about the virtual headset so far, we haven’t exactly had a substantial showing of it, nor have we been able to properly see it in action (if at all). That, however, might soon be about to change.

Speaking during his recent Giant Bomb show GrubbSnax, journalist Jeff Grubb said that he’s heard “rumblings” Sony might be preparing to show off the PSVR2 in “a more substantial way” very soon. According to Grubb, some of it might even be related to E3 (or the traditional E3 period, since there is no E3 this year anymore), and might even be the referring to the June Sony event that may or may not be happening.

That’s a lot of variables, of course, so given the shaky nature of this story, it’s best to take it with a healthy grain of salt for now, especially given how tight-lipped Sony as a company likes to be. The PSVR2 is, according to reports, targeting an early 2023 launch, and if that is indeed the case, it would make sense for Sony to properly show it off in the coming weeks and months. Again, though, with nothing have yet been confirmed, tread with caution for now.
